Introduction

LED lighting circuits are a simple and efficient way to provide illumination for a variety of applications. They rely on the relatively low voltage drop and high efficiency of LEDs, meaning that they can be connected in series or parallel to provide more intensity or longer runs. LED lighting circuits often contain additional components such as capacitors, resistors, and diodes in order to regulate the power of the circuit and reduce losses through heat loss. A driver is also required to regulate the LED output current, ensuring that it stays within the maximum allowable limit for safety reasons. The desired amount of light produced by an LED lighting circuit can be adjusted with dimmers and other controls, allowing an installer greater flexibility in designing and configuring their system.

Working Explanation

of LED Lighting Circuit Diagram

The consumer unit (or 'electricity meter') cupboard in some houses is often a badly lit place as far as natural light is concerned. If the bell transformer is likewise placed in this cupboard, it is able to be used to provide emergency lights by way of two excessive-modern leds. Those diodes are powered thru a small circuit that switches over to 4 nicd batteries whilst the mains fail.

The output voltage of the bell transformer is rectified by bridge B1‚and buffered by capacitor C1. The batteries are charged constantly with a present-day of about 7.5 ma thru diode d1‚ and resistor r2. The base of transistor T1 (BC557B)‚ is high through
R3, so that the transistor will be cut off.

When the mains voltage fails, C1‚is discharged via R1; when the potential across the capacitor has dropped to a given value, the battery voltage switches on T1 via R3, and R1‚ provided switch S1‚ is closed. When T1‚is on, a current of some 20 mA flows through diodes D4 and D5. The light from those leds is sufficient to permit the illness fuse or the tripped circuit
breaker to be located.

Conclusion

LED lighting is a cost-effective and energy-efficient alternative to traditional lighting. Through its use of lower wattage and directional light, LED lighting can produce a significantly higher lumen output per watt than traditional bulbs, saving you money on energy bills. Its cooler temperature also reduces heat in the environment, making it more comfortable for humans and less damaging to the environment. Its long lifespan means that you don't need to replace it as often and its low maintenance requirements make it easier on your budget in the long run. All these benefits make LED lighting an attractive choice for any home or business owner looking to reduce their energy costs while still achieving great illumination.
